What is meant by the value of colour?

The value of a color is how dark or light it is. This is also called tones or shades. For example navy is a dark value and baby blue is a light value, even thought they are the exact same color.

What is meant by color management?

"Colour management" refers to digital imaging, it is the controlled conversion of colour on devices such as scanners and monitors (TV etc). Colour management helps to homogenise colour appearances of various devices.
